Precautions

Even though just about anyone can work towards achieving cardiovascular fitness, check with a physician to learn how to moderate your activity if you:

* Have a medical condition like diabetes, high cholesterol, high blood pressure, or any heart or respiratory problem
* Are a smoker over age 35, or are inactive over age 40
* Feel great discomfort or pain when you move or exercise
* Are recovering from a cold or flu (raised body temperature mixed with activity can result in dizziness and fainting)
* Have been injured and have not yet healed
* Lose your breath and cannot speak comfortably while exercising



Workout Overview

Once you’re ready to exercise, consider the forms of activities that best suit your body, health conditions, and lifestyle. Remember to alternate between different workouts in order to avoid tiring from one kind. Consider the pros and cons of each activity in the following cardiovascular activity overview to choose what fits you:

The most practical choice is walking;
however, if burning calories is your purpose, other activities, such as jogging, will provide quicker calorie expenditure. Keep in mind though that although jogging sheds more pounds, it can be tough on the knees, hips, and ankles over time. An alternative would be jogging on grass or sand to reduce the hard pound.
